A Exposure Compensation
In P, S, and A modes, exposure can be adjusted by ±5 EV in increments of
1
/3 EV (0 90).
Note
that the effects of values over +3 EV or under –3 EV can not be previewed in the monitor.
A HDMI
When the camera is attached to an HDMI video device, the
camera monitor will turn off and the video device will display
the view through the lens as shown at right.
